Vytvoření doplňku
Doplněk je modul plug-in, který také načítá knihovny DLL, zpřístupňující nová rozhraní API jazyka JavaScript.
Stáhnutí rozhraní FormIt API
K vytvoření knihoven DLL, které podporují aplikaci FormIt, je nutné rozhraní FormIt API. Rozhraní FormIt API lze stáhnout z webu Autodesk Developer Network. Ke stažení je nutné přihlášení.
Po přihlášení je rozhraní FormIt API dostupné v části SOFTWARE.
Doplněk má přístup k rozhraní FormIt API a FormIt Modeling Kernel C++ API.
Doplněk má následující strukturu:
K načtení argumentů do proměnných C++ použijte příkaz SCRIPTCONVERTER-
Vrátit lze buď JSON_UNDEFINED, nebo libovolný objekt JSON. Pomocí funkce to_json převeďte proměnnou C++ na json.
Jakmile knihovna DLL definuje všechna potřebná rozhraní API JS, musí modul plug-in aplikaci FormIt sdělit, které knihovny DLL je třeba načíst. To se provádí v souboru manifestu.
HelloAddIn je funkční příklad, který vysvětluje, jak vytvořit doplněk.
HelloWSMAddIn je funkční příklad, který vysvětluje, jak vytvořit doplněk pomocí rozhraní FormIt Modelling Kernel C++ API.
Last updated